Antique Victorian French Diamond Ivy Bracelet 18ct Gold
A stunning antique French Art Nouveau bracelet from the late 19th Century, modelled in solid 18ct yellow gold. Each open-work link sits flat against the wrist and is decorated with scrolling motifs and ivy leaves, with a silver line of twinkling rose cut diamonds running down the centre (approx. 0.40ct total).
Ivy was a romantic jewellery motif in the 19th Century, representing a strong, loving bond between two people that was not easily broken, as in the Victorian rhyme; “Close clings the ivy to the tree, so in my heart I cling to thee”.
This exquisite French Art Nouveau bracelet displays exceptional workmanship and is in excellent condition. It has a pleasing weight to it and is held securely by a box clasp at the end, complete with French hallmarks.
